What is AWS Free Tier and how does it benefit users?
AWS Free Tier is a program that offers new AWS customers a free usage tier for certain AWS services for up to 12 months. This allows users to explore and experiment with AWS services without incurring any costs. The free tier includes services like Amazon EC2, Amazon S3, and Amazon RDS, among others, providing users with a hands-on experience of the AWS platform at no cost.
What are the eligibility criteria for accessing the AWS Free Tier account?
To be eligible for the AWS Free Tier, users must be new AWS customers who have not previously signed up for an AWS account. Additionally, users must provide valid payment information during the sign-up process, as some services may exceed the free tier limits, resulting in charges beyond the free usage limits.
How can users sign up for an AWS Free Tier account?
Users can sign up for an AWS Free Tier account by visiting the AWS website and creating an AWS account. During the account creation process, users will be prompted to provide necessary information, including payment details for verification purposes. Once the account is set up, users can start exploring the free tier services available within the AWS console.
What are some common misconceptions about the AWS Free Tier program?
One common misconception is that the free tier is unlimited, which is not the case. The free tier has usage limits for each service, and exceeding these limits may result in charges. Another misconception is that all AWS services are included in the free tier, but in reality, only select services are part of the free tier offering.
How can users avoid unexpected charges while using the AWS Free Tier?
To avoid unexpected charges while using the AWS Free Tier, users should closely monitor their usage through the AWS Management Console. Setting up billing alerts can help users track their usage and receive notifications before exceeding the free tier limits. Additionally, users can leverage AWS Cost Explorer to analyze their usage patterns and optimize resource allocation to stay within the free tier limits.
